We were at the Otağtepe of the Bosphorus (Otağ Hill means marquee hill). There is a wonderful park at this hill and you can watch the Bosphorus.

Perched atop Otagtepe Hill near Istanbul’s Fatih Sultan Mehmet Bridge, the Tema Vehbi Koç Park is a wonderful tribute to the city’s stunning nature. Established as a conservationist project by renowned Turkish industrialist Vehbi Koç, this beautiful park boats its own heliport, walking paths, a pond and many areas to appreciate the Bosphorus views.

Otağtepe is in the Anatolian side and I took these pictures from this hill. On the right side of the photograph, you can see the Bosphorus goes to the Black Sea… It reaches like a snake to the Black Sea.
